Born in 1981 to Kandakatla Buchamma and Kandakatla Krishna Reddy, Siddu grew up understanding the struggles of economic hardship. His mother supported the family by selling vegetables, instilling in him a deep respect for hard work and a commitment to uplifting others. Inspired by his humble beginnings, Reddy pursued education in his hometown before establishing Kandakatla’s KSR Projects, a business that has enabled him to channel resources into philanthropy.
